Joseph Riedel, chief of the Nazi organization in Argentina, was slain Sunday night in what appeared to be a squabble with fellow Hitlerites over use of party funds, it was disclosed here today for the first time, the Havas News Agency reported.
Available information indicated Communists or other anti-Nazis were in no way connected with Riedel’s death.
